Karachi (Staff Reporter) Cyclone Tej formed in the Arabian Sea has turned into a very severe storm and is seventeen hundred kilometers away from Karachi. has changed. The Department of Meteorology has issued another alert, the storm is fifteen kilometers from Gwadar and seventeen hundred kilometers from Karachi. According to the Department of Meteorology, 

the storm that formed in the Arabian Sea became very intense in 12 hours, the distance of the storm is south of Oman. It is 270 km from the west and 70 km from the city of Al Gheida in Yemen. The Meteorological Department said that the storm has winds of 130 to 140 and a maximum of 160 km per hour, waves around the storm are 30 feet high.

 The Department of Meteorology said that Cyclone Tej will move towards the northwest in the next few hours and cross the Al-Ghaida coast of Yemen. The winds of the center of the storm will be 120 to 130 km when crossing the Al-Ghaida coast. The Department of Meteorology said that the hurricane There is no threat to any coastline of Pakistan.
